English
Language : 

EMC1438 Datasheet, PDF (17/48 Pages) SMSC Corporation – 1°C Multiple Temperature Sensor with Hardware Controlled Standby & Hottest of Multiple Zones
1°C Multiple Temperature Sensor with Hardware Controlled Standby & Hottest of Multiple Zones
Datasheet
Chapter 5 Product Description
The EMC1438 is an SMBus temperature sensor that monitors up to seven (7) external diodes and one
internal diode.
Thermal management is performed in cooperation with a host device. This consists of the host reading
the temperature data of both the external and internal temperature diodes of the EMC1438 and using
that data to control the speed of one or more fans.
The EMC1438 provides two levels of monitoring. The first EMC1438 provides a maskable ALERT
signal to the host when measured temperatures meet or exceed user programmable limits. This allows
the EMC1438 to be used as an independent thermal watchdog to warn the host of temperature hot
spots without constant monitoring by the host. The second level of monitoring provides a non-maskable
interrupt on the THERM pin if the measured values meet or exceed a second programmable limit.
Because the EMC1438 automatically corrects for temperature errors due to series resistance in
temperature diode lines, there is greater flexibility in where external diodes are positioned and better
measurement accuracy than previously available devices without resistance error correction. As well,
the automatic beta detection feature means that there is no need to program the device according to
which type of diode is present. Therefore, the device can power up ready to operate for any system
configuration including those diodes that require the BJT or transistor model.
Figure 5.1 shows a system level block diagram of the EMC1438.
CPU
Optional
anti-
parallel
diodes
Optional
anti-
parallel
diodes
Optional
anti-
parallel
diodes
VDD
EMC1438
DP1
THERM
DN1
SMDATA
SMCLK
DP2 / DN3
ALERT
DN2 / DP3
DP4 / DN5
DN4 / DP5
DP6 / DN7
STANDBY
ADDR_SEL
DN6 / DP7
Host
SMBus
Interface
Figure 5.1 System Diagram for EMC1438
5.1 Register Bits
Unless otherwise stated when a bit is “set”, it is written to a logic ‘1’. Likewise when a bit is “cleared”,
it is written to a logic ‘0’.
SMSC EMC1438
17
DATASHEET
Revision 1.0 (04-29-10)